App Platform has no persistent volumes, so Fabro's /storage directory
rules it out. Documents the Droplet path instead, using the existing
docker-compose.prod.yaml + Caddy setup for automatic TLS.

fly.toml points Fly directly at ghcr.io/fabro-sh/fabro:nightly (no
builder step), pins internal_port to 32276 since Fly does not inject
$PORT, declares a Volume mount at /storage, and disables autostop so
the run queue stays live under no HTTP traffic.
Replaces the deploy-fly-io.mdx stub with a CLI-first walkthrough
covering volume creation, secrets, dev token retrieval, and the
single-Machine / single-Volume caveats that apply to Fabro.

The shipped aarch64-unknown-linux-musl binary segfaulted at startup on
every arm64 runtime (Apple Silicon, Graviton, Ampere, Docker arm64).
Root cause: a glibc-vs-musl .init_array calling-convention mismatch --
a C static library in the dep graph has an __attribute__((constructor))
that expects (argc, argv, envp) per glibc, but musl on aarch64 calls
it with no args, so register garbage propagates into pointer arithmetic
and faults before main runs.
Switch the musl compile steps to cargo-zigbuild (zig 0.13.0). Zig's
bundled cc + lld produce working static-PIE binaries for both musl
targets, sidestepping Ubuntu musl-tools' -no-pie quirk and the
init_array ordering that triggered the crash. Drop the CARGO_TARGET_*
linker overrides and the musl-tools apt install -- zig handles both.
bin/dev/docker-build.sh mirrors the same toolchain so the local Docker
image build matches CI.
Verified by running fabro version from the resulting arm64 image on
ghcr.io/fabro-sh/dhi-alpine-base:3.23-dev, alpine:3.22, and
debian:stable-slim -- all print the version banner with exit 0.
